Madonna Returns with Veronica Electronica Remix Album, Breathing New Life into Her Iconic Sound

July 8, 2025 - by Jande David - Leave a Comment

Madonna is back in the spotlight with exciting news for music lovers and longtime fans alike—she’s preparing to release a brand-new remix album titled Veronica Electronica. After more than four decades of chart-topping hits and fearless artistic reinvention, the pop legend is once again shaking things up. This time, she’s diving deep into her catalog to give her classics an electrified makeover, creating a bold bridge between the past and the future of dance music.

The album title may ring a bell for devoted followers of Madonna’s career. Veronica Electronica has been whispered about since the early 2000s, originally surfacing as a rumored project that never materialized. Now, more than 20 years later, the name is being revived—this time for real. Whether the new release draws from that original vision or represents a completely new artistic direction, it’s clear that Madonna is ready to explore her musical legacy through a new lens, reimagining it with the kind of forward-thinking creativity she’s known for.

Although the official tracklist and lineup of collaborators remain a mystery, expectations are high. Madonna has always surrounded herself with influential producers, remixers, and DJs who have helped shape her sound across eras—from Nile Rodgers and William Orbit to Stuart Price and Diplo. Her past remix albums, including You Can Dance (1987) and various deluxe reissues, have not only been fan favorites but have also set benchmarks for how remixes can be elevated into full artistic statements. With Veronica Electronica, listeners are hoping for a fresh synthesis of her signature vocals, timeless melodies, and pulsing, experimental beats.

The timing of this project couldn’t be more fitting. The current music landscape is seeing a renewed interest in remixes and electronic reinterpretations. From legacy acts to Gen Z stars, artists are mining their discographies to breathe new life into beloved songs. Madonna, who helped define electronic-pop crossovers with her albums Ray of Light and Confessions on a Dance Floor, is uniquely positioned to lead this wave. Her continued relevance in club culture and pop innovation shows she’s still an essential voice in the evolution of mainstream music.

Though an official release date for Veronica Electronica has yet to be revealed, the buzz surrounding the announcement is undeniable. Online fan communities and social media platforms are alive with speculation and excitement, fueled by Madonna’s ability to turn surprise drops into major cultural events. She’s always been an artist who looks forward, even when reflecting on her past—and this remix album appears to be the latest proof of that enduring drive.

Whether Veronica Electronica emerges as a nostalgic homage or a completely reimagined experience, Madonna’s message is clear: her journey as a boundary-pusher is far from over. By remixing her past, she isn’t just revisiting it—she’s rewriting it in real time, with the same boldness that made her a pop legend to begin with.
